KEEPING UP WITH THE KARDASHIAN­S: A DECADE OF REALITY TV 10 years on the scene and still going strong.

- Kgosi Modisane

K eeping Up with the Kardashian­s, which is celebratin­g a decade in the reality TV series space, has grown steadily from a docu-series into a global phenomenon.

From break-ups to make-ups, weddings, births and all the drama in between, fans have “kept up” with the family’s constant evolution.

The first season, in 2007, introduced the world to Hollywood’s royal family of Ks – sisters Kim, Khloé, Kourtney, Kendall and Kylie and their mother Kris Kardashian.

Since its debut, fans of the series have lived each jaw-dropping moment which has seen the Kardashian name turn into a lucrative business with a net worth of over R 600 million.

Executive vice-president for programmin­g and developmen­t at E! Jeff Olde says “since the show’s inception 10 years ago, viewers have watched the family evolve, grow and become a huge part of today’s pop culture zeitgeist”.

“In celebratin­g the family’s decade on air, we are extremely grateful for the fans all over the world who have ‘kept up’ since the beginning.”

To commemorat­e this achievemen­t, hosting channel E! Entertainm­ent showcased a Look Book Special on the Kardashian and Jenner sisters’ fashion style and signature looks.

The series ran from September from the 12 to 16.

It will be followed up with reruns of the past decade, where fans will be given the opportunit­y to catch up on every episode of Keeping Up with the Kardashian­s ever aired.

On Monday, a 90-minute Keeping Up with the Kardashian­s 10year anniversar­y special will air at 8pm.

Host and executive producer of the series and special, Ryan Seacrest, sits down with Kris to reflect on the most monumental events in their lives.

Throughout the years, the family has remained genuine, compassion­ate and vulnerable with the viewers, and this special will delve into what it’s been like for the family to live all the triumphs and hardships in front of the camera.

Fans of the show will also get an opportunit­y to vote for their favourite episodes to be showcased on October 7 by voting on the E! Africa Facebook page.

Then, after a heavy and eventful year, a new fun and flirty 14th season of the reality series returns on October 8th at 8pm.

From backyard camping and wine tasting in Santa Barbara to jet-setting to Mexico for birthday shenanigan­s, the family is determined to get back to basics, but not without some challenges along the way.

Kim debates removing herself from the spotlight to focus on her family after the traumatic experience in Paris.
